Mastering the Art of the Dodge: Fundamental Strategies

Successfully navigating the treacherous roadways in these games isn’t just about luck; it’s about developing a keen understanding of the traffic flow and honing your reactive skills. Initially, focus on identifying patterns in the vehicle movements. Are cars appearing more frequently from one side of the screen? Is there a predictable gap between vehicles that you can exploit? Observing these nuances is crucial for long-term survival. Don’t simply react to the cars closest to you; anticipate their future positions. Beginners often get caught out by vehicles momentarily hidden behind others, emphasizing the importance of scanning the entire road ahead.

Furthermore, mastering the control scheme is paramount. Most iterations utilize simple tap or swipe controls, but even these require practice to achieve optimal precision. Experiment with different timings for your movements to find what feels most comfortable and responsive. Avoid erratic or jerky motions, as these can lead to miscalculations and inevitable collisions. A smoother, more deliberate approach will yield better results. Remember that patience is also a virtue; sometimes, waiting for a clear opening is preferable to attempting a risky maneuver. Aggressive play can be rewarding, but often leads to swift and comical demise.

Understanding Power-Ups and Their Impact

Beyond skillful dodging, effective utilization of power-ups is essential for maximizing your score and extending your survival. Many of these games feature a variety of collectible items that temporarily augment the chicken's abilities. Common examples include speed boosts, temporary invincibility, and score multipliers. Prioritize collecting those that best suit your playstyle and the current game conditions. For instance, a speed boost can be invaluable when attempting to navigate particularly dense traffic, while invincibility offers peace of mind during chaotic moments. However, timing their use is crucial; activating a power-up at the wrong moment can negate its benefits.

Keep an eye on the frequency and placement of power-ups throughout the course. Learning where they typically spawn allows you to strategically position yourself to collect them efficiently. Some games even introduce power-downs, which can hinder your progress. Quickly identifying and avoiding these negative effects is just as important as grabbing the beneficial ones. Mastering the interplay between dodging, collecting, and utilizing power-ups separates casual players from true highway poultry professionals.

Power-Up
Effect
Strategic Use
Speed Boost Increases the chicken’s movement speed. Useful for navigating dense traffic or reaching distant power-ups.
Invincibility Grants temporary immunity to collisions. Ideal for risky maneuvers or periods of intense traffic.
Score Multiplier Increases the points earned for a limited time. Activate during long, successful runs to maximize points.
Magnet Attracts nearby coins or power-ups. Helps to secure valuable items without precise positioning.

Understanding how each power-up alters gameplay affects both your score and longevity, leading to more strategic playthroughs. Focusing on maximizing the benefit from each pickup creates a more challenging, yet ultimately rewarding, experience.

Advanced Techniques: Beyond Basic Dodging

Once you've mastered the fundamentals, there's a wealth of advanced techniques that can significantly improve your performance. One crucial element is learning to predict vehicle speeds. While traffic patterns may seem random, subtle cues can indicate whether a car is accelerating or decelerating. Paying attention to these visual clues allows you to make more informed decisions about when to cross. Another technique involves utilizing the edges of the screen to anticipate vehicles entering the frame. This gives you a precious split-second to react. Practice these techniques in isolation to build muscle memory and refine your timing.

Furthermore, don't underestimate the power of controlled risk-taking. Sometimes, attempting a seemingly impossible crossing can be the fastest way to accumulate points and reach the end of the road. However, this requires careful calculation and a healthy dose of confidence. Knowing when to push your limits and when to play it safe is a skill that develops with experience. Experiment with different strategies and analyze your failures to identify areas for improvement. Mastering these advanced techniques transforms you from a competent player to a true road-crossing virtuoso.
